Emmanuel Baptist Church is ministry to people. The first family that Malone reached<br />

were the Johnsons. The father, a barber, was led to the Lord, along with his whole family, and<br />

young Tom Malone baptized them. Later, Malone endured the grief of burying their beautiful<br />

young daughter. Farther along in his ministry, he saw their other children graduate from Bob<br />

Jones University. According to Dr. Malone, “Praise God, the converts have continued with<br />

Christ over the years.” People have come from little shacks by the railroad, they have come from<br />

mansions, they have come from offices, they have come from farms in surrounding areas. But,<br />

most important, they have come to Christ.<br />

Many of the congregation count the greatest victory as the 4,670 who attended Sunday<br />

School on February 6, 1972. This year the church plans a “Feed the 5,000” celebration for its<br />

30th anniversary, when they will gather the largest crowd in the history of the church. Dr.<br />

Malone is projecting a $30,000 offering when he challenges his people to “Change places with<br />

God.” He announced recently that most people give God 10 per cent and keep 90 per cent. He<br />

said, “Let’s see how we can get along with God’s 10 per cent.” Malone plans to give $15,000 of<br />

the offering that day to missions. Last year the church gave $100,000 to foreign missions. Last<br />

year the church baptized 1,193, the fourth most in the nation, according to The Sword of the<br />

Lord. Malone wants to baptize 200 on his 30th anniversary, and his visitation program is planned<br />

to that end.<br />

THE FUTURE<br />

Malone sees explosive growth within the near future. He projects a weekly attendance of<br />

3,000 this fall. This is a distinct possibility, for within three months a new building will be<br />

completed that will seat an extra 900 for Sunday School. The church is just finishing a $600,000<br />

expansion program and its total indebtedness is only $300,000 out of total assets of $3 million.<br />

The continued growth of Midwestern Baptist College will contribute to the growth of the church,<br />

along with a new. print shop; the new special services and a continued program of personal<br />

evangelism make the future bright.<br />

Chapter Fifteen<br />

South Sheridan Baptist Church,<br />

Denver, Colorado Ed Nelson, Pastor<br />

“Mr. Fundamentalist Pastors the Fastest Growing Church in the Rocky<br />

Mountains”<br />

The fastest growing church in the Rocky Mountains is pastored by Dr. Ed Nelson, known<br />

throughout the area as “Mr. Fundamentalist.” The rapid expansion of the South Sheridan Baptist<br />

Church, Denver, destroys the false theory that a church must soften its stand on separation to<br />

attract modern Americans who are pleasure-inclined and self-indulgent. In contrast, the<br />

fundamentalist stand doesn’t hinder the church’s outreach, but helps it. Sunday School has<br />
